Serve Those Who Serve – Flexible, Mission-Driven Urgent Care Opportunity in Dumfries, VA

 

Spectrum Healthcare Resources is actively hiring a civilian Physician Assistant to provide Urgent Care services at the Dumfries Ambulatory Health Center in Dumfries, Virginia. This is a unique opportunity to deliver high-quality, patient-centered care to active-duty service members, veterans, and their families in the National Capital Region — all within a collaborative and well-resourced clinical setting.

 

Why this Role Stands Out

  • Mission-Driven Care – Serve a grateful, insured patient population (Tricare: active-duty military, qualifying veterans & dependents)

  • Supportive Environment – Work alongside dedicated nursing and MA staff, with strong leadership and stable culture

  • Full Access to Specialty Services – Radiology, pediatrics, pharmacy, and lab conveniently located in the same building

  • No High-Risk Triage – BLS-only facility with no crash carts; higher acuity cases are transferred

Flexible Schedule

  • Part-Time | 16 hours/week

  • Evening Shifts | 4 days/week from 4:00 PM – 8:00 PM

  • Urgent Care Hours: M–F: 7:00 AM–8:00 PM | Sat: 8:00 AM–2:00 PM

Benefits & Perks

  • Competitive Compensation

  • Comprehensive Benefits – Medical, dental, vision, 401k, life insurance & more

  • Generous Time Off – Paid time off, paid sick leave, 11 paid Federal Holidays

  • Paid CME Time – Invest in your professional growth

  • All patients are insured through Tricare – no billing headaches or uninsured care

Role Expectations

  • Provide fast-paced care at 2–3 patients per hour

  • Deliver treatment within the clinic’s BLS-level scope

  • Work as an extension of Ft. Belvoir’s Emergency Department – patients requiring higher-level care are seamlessly transferred

  • Collaborate with seasoned physicians and experienced clinical leadership

Qualifications

  • Graduate of an accredited PA program

  • Any active U.S. state license

  • Minimum 1 year of experience in Urgent Care or Emergency Medicine

  • Active BLS and ACLS certifications

  • Active DEA registration

About Prince William County, Virginia:

 

Prince William County is situated on the Potomac River, just over 30 miles southwest of D.C. This vibrant area is highly sought-after and encompasses over 12 unique cities and communities. Blessed with numerous natural resources and an endless array of attractions, visitors and residents alike can enjoy big-city amenities without the hassles of living directly in a metropolis. Some highlights include: 

 

  • Play a round at Potomac Shores Golf Club, voted one of the top ten golf courses in the U.S 
  • Step back in time and visit one of the many historical sites to learn more about the history of our great Nation 
  • Get outside and explore beautiful outdoor spaces, state parks, and waterways. Hike, bike, kayak, fish, horseback ride, and more
  • Take a day trip to D.C., Richmond, or beautiful Lake Anna
